问题
单项选择题
下列关于对象概念的描述中,正确的是( )。
A) 对象就是C语言中的结构变量
B) 对象代表着正在创建的系统中的一个实体
C) 对象是一个状态和操作(或方法)的封装体
D) 对象之间的信息传递是通过消息进行的
答案
参考答案:D
解析: 对象之间的信息传递是通过消息进行的。对象=方法(函数)+属性(数据),而C语言的结构体其实就是不同类型数据的组合。并没有处理数据的方法。
下列关于对象概念的描述中,正确的是( )。
A) 对象就是C语言中的结构变量
B) 对象代表着正在创建的系统中的一个实体
C) 对象是一个状态和操作(或方法)的封装体
D) 对象之间的信息传递是通过消息进行的
参考答案:D
解析: 对象之间的信息传递是通过消息进行的。对象=方法(函数)+属性(数据),而C语言的结构体其实就是不同类型数据的组合。并没有处理数据的方法。